1. Understanding Differentiation from First Principles | 从基本原理理解微分

The derivative is formally defined as the limit of the average rate of change as the interval approaches zero. For a function f(x), the derivative f'(x) is given by the following expression:

导数的正式定义是当区间趋近于零时平均变化率的极限。对于函数f(x),导数f'(x)由以下表达式给出:

f'(x) = lim(h→0) [f(x+h) − f(x)] / h

This definition is known as differentiation from first principles. In the AQA examination, you may be asked to apply this definition to simple polynomial functions, such as f(x) = x² or f(x) = x³.

这个定义被称为从基本原理出发的微分。在AQA考试中,可能会要求你将此定义应用于简单的多项式函数,如f(x) = x²或f(x) = x³。

For example, if f(x) = x², then f(x+h) = (x+h)² = x² + 2xh + h². Substituting into the definition:

例如,若f(x) = x²,则f(x+h) = (x+h)² = x² + 2xh + h²。将其代入定义:

f'(x) = lim(h→0) [(x² + 2xh + h²) − x²] / h = lim(h→0) (2x + h) = 2x

As h approaches zero, the term 2x + h approaches 2x, giving us the familiar result. This process forms the foundation of all calculus and is worth practising thoroughly.

当h趋近于零时,2x + h这一项趋近于2x,从而得到我们熟悉的结果。这个过程构成了所有微积分的基础,值得反复练习。
